Dredging for Naval Weapons Station Seal Beach (NWSSB)

Notice ID:W912PL25BA011

This project involves dredging approximately 80,000 cubic yards of sediment in the open waters of the Pacific Ocean near Anaheim Bay, with placement at two separate disposal sites. The work is for Naval Weapons Station Seal Beach to maintain an inner approach channel to a depth of -41 feet MLLW and a width of 280 feet. The project site is exposed to a high-energy wave environment with typical wave heights over 5 feet and long wave periods, posing significant operational challenges. The performance location is the Pacific Ocean at the entrance to Anaheim Bay for Naval Weapons Station Seal Beach.
